18 /**
19 * A General purpose Container. This figure is opaque by default, and will fill its entire
20 * bounds with either the background color that is set on the figure, or the IGraphics
21 * current background color if none has been set. Opaque figures help to optimize
22 * painting.
23 * <p>
24 * Note that the paintFigure() method in the superclass Figure actually fills the bounds
25 * of this figure.
26 */
27 public class Panel
28 : Figure
29 {
30
31 /**
32 * Returns <code>true</code> as this is an opaque figure.
33 *
34 * @return the opaque state of this figure
35 * @since 2.0
36 */
37 public bool isOpaque() {
38 return true;
39 }
40
41 }
